Braves Lead 1-0 In 2021 World Series After Game 1

The World Series embarked last night with an exciting Game 1. While the Houston Astros entered the matchup as the favorite, the Atlanta Braves defeated the Astros 6-2.

The Braves had a productive and efficient offensive evening as Adam Duvall and Jorge Soler both drove in two runs. Braves’ starting pitcher, Charlie Morton, was strong through the first two innings before he limped off the field and was declared injured and unable to play for the rest of the series. The Braves’ bullpen held the fiery Astros’ lineup to only two runs after Morton’s departure.

Now, down 1-0, the Astros look to strike back in Game 2 while still in Houston. Astros’ pitcher, Jose Urquidy, will face veteran Braves’ starter, Max Fried. Both starting pitchers posted solid numbers throughout the season and the playoffs as they hope to give their respective teams a chance to snag Game 2.
